Water Heater Leak Water Removal Cost In Sanger, TX

The cost of water heater leak water removal can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sanger, TX. Our prices range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the extent of the damage. Get a free estimate today to find out the exact cost of your water heater leak water removal job.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, amount of water extracted
Drying and Dehumidification $300 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Restoration and Repair $1,000 – $3,000 Extent of damage, type of materials affected
Water Heater Replacement $1,500 – $3,500 Type of water heater, age and condition of the unit
More Services (mold remediation, air duct cleaning) $500 – $2,000 Type of service, size of affected area

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ates for all our services. Get a quote today and let us help you restore your property to its original condition.

Common Questions About Water Heater Leak Water Removal

Q: What causes water heater leaks?

A: Water heater le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including corrosion, rust, and worn-out parts. Regular maintenance can help prevent leaks and extend the life of your water heater.
